USA East Coast Hurricane Power Outages Disrupt Communications

As many of you are aware, the Eastern USA has experienced a Hurricane and Tropical Storm over the weekend. Particularly affected are the States of North Carolina, Maryland, Delaware, New Jersey, and New York.

The IAM, International Association of Movers has heard from several IAM Members in the areas affected who have reported their electricity, phones, and computer services (email) have been knocked out.

Due to the widespread damage, some of these areas may be out of power for quite some time. With restoration efforts being hampered by flooding, parts of New Jersey may not have their power restored until September 4th.

Abels Moving Services has received confirmation of its partners continuing to operate and that storage facilities whilst being effected have escaped the worst of the storm and customers possessions are safe, dry and covered.

PORTS – We understand the ocean ports in the affected areas are operating normally, with minimal disruptions.

Abels are checking on our shipments moving in or out of these USA East Coast ports, and we have been advised of a number of delays where vessels have been held back to avoid danger instead of entering their designated berth. Small backlogs are being experienced which should be resolved relatively quickly.

AIRPORTS – JFK and Newark International Airports reopened on Tuesday morning the 30th ; however, it is expected to take several days of repositioning planes and crews before service returns to normal flight schedules.
